The 2025 Grant Thornton Invitational takes place for the third time with 16 mixed pairings teeing it up at Tiburon Golf Club from December 12-14.
This unique mixed-team event features 32 players from the PGA Tour and LPGA Tour, competing in 16 mixed pairs for a purse of $4 million.
The tournament boasts an impressive field from both tours participating in Florida including the previous two winnings pairs of Patty Tavatanakit & Jake Knapp and Jason Day & Lydia Ko.
Among the other names teeing it up are Nelly Korda, who tops the betting odds, sister Jessica on her return to golf, Charley Hull, Lottie Woad, Brooke Henderson, Lexi Thompson and Lilia Vu.
From the PGA Tour, Billy Horschel, Wyndham Clark and Keith Mitchell are among the male members of the pairings.
2025 Grant Thornton Invitational Teams & Pairings
The 16 teams competing in the 2025 Grant Thornton Invitational are:
- Patty Tavatanakit & Jake Knapp
- Lydia Ko & Jason Day
- Lilia Vu & Tony Finau
- Nelly Korda & Denny McCarthy
- Jessica Korda & Bud Cauley
- Brooke Henderson & Corey Conners
- Andrea Lee & Billy Horschel
- Charley Hull & Michael Brennan
- Lottie Woad & Luke Clanton
- Lexi Thompson & Wyndham Clark
- Jennifer Kupcho & Chris Gotterup
- Rose Zhang & Michael Kim
- Lauren Coughlin & Andrew Novak
- Maja Stark & Neal Shipley
- Angel Yin & Tom Hoge
- Megan Khang & Keith Mitchell
2025 Grant Thornton Invitational Format
The competition takes place over three days with different formats used – Scramble, Foursomes and Modified Four-Ball – across the three rounds
Scramble (Round 1): Both players tee off, then select the best shot to play from, continuing this process until the ball is holed.
Foursomes (Round 2): Players alternate shots using the same ball until the hole is completed.
Modified Four-Ball (Round 3): Both players tee off, then switch balls for their second shots, playing that ball until it’s holed. The lower score of the pair counts as the team score.
